
In 2018, Trump launched the trade war by imposing 25% tariffs on steel and 10% on aluminum. His logic? Protect American jobs and punish China, Mexico, and Europe for what he saw as unfair trade. But tariffs aren’t just numbers; they raise prices on everyday goods — from toys to cars — affecting everyone. It’s like a gun fired blindly, hitting everyone in its path.
